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Storage equipment and control method thereof

A technology of a storage device and a control method, applied in the storage field, can solve the problems of reducing the writing speed of a semiconductor storage device, the operation time occupied by an effective page, etc., and achieve the effects of reducing the number of empty block recovery times and improving the data writing speed.

Inactive Publication Date: 2010-07-07
NETAK TECH KO LTD
View PDF0 Cites 2 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0005] However, when empty blocks are reclaimed during the above-mentioned process of writing data, the relocation of valid pages takes a certain amount of operation time, so too many empty block reclaims will reduce the writing speed of semiconductor storage devices

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Storage equipment and control method thereof
  • Storage equipment and control method thereof
  • Storage equipment and control method thereof

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0025] figure 1 Shown is a storage device 1 in an embodiment of the present invention, the storage device 1 includes a controller 11 and at least one semiconductor storage medium 12 , and may also include a memory 13 . As previously mentioned, the memory 13 can be a random access memory inside the controller 11 of the storage device (such as figure 1 shown), it may also be a synchronous DRAM external to the controller 11.

[0026] figure 2 show figure 1 Controller 11 shown. The controller 11 includes a first unit 111 and a second unit 112, wherein:

[0027] The first unit 111 establishes the mapping relationship between some logical addresses of the storage device 1 and the physical addresses of the empty blocks in the semiconductor storage medium 12 , and records the information of the empty blocks without mapping relationship in the semiconductor storage medium 12 .

[0028] The second unit 112 operates on empty blocks without a mapping relationship.

[0029] In one e...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ention provides storage equipment and a control method thereof. The storage equipment comprises a semiconductor storage medium. The method comprises the following steps of: establishing a mapping relationship of a partial logic address and a physical address of a semiconductor storage address hollow block; recording information of a hollow block without the mapping relationship; and operating the hollow block without the mapping relationship. The storage equipment and the control method thereof can effectively reduce the recovery times of the hollow block in the data write-in process, thereby improving the speed of writing in the data.

Description

technical field [0001] The present invention relates to memory technology, and more particularly, to memory technology in semiconductor memory devices. Background technique [0002] For semiconductor storage devices, such as flash memory devices, generally at least one flash memory medium is included. Flash media consists of a number of physical blocks. Each physical block has a physical address. In order to perform read and write operations on physical blocks, it is necessary to establish a mapping relationship between physical addresses and logical addresses. This mapping relationship is recorded in the address mapping table. [0003] Before the flash medium is used, all physical blocks are empty blocks (that is, physical blocks that do not contain any data). In order to improve the access speed, when establishing the mapping relationship between physical addresses and logical addresses, in addition to establishing a mapping relationship between all logical addresses a...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F12/06
Inventor 卢赛文
Owner NETAK TECH KO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products